AGGPTPVI ;VNGT/HS/ALA-Private Insurance ; 26 Apr 2010 5:18 PM
Source file <AGGPTPVI.m>
Name | Comments | DBIA/ICR reference |
---|---|---|
COV(DATA,AGGPIINS) | ;EP - AGG INSUR COV TRIGGER
|
|
HDR | ;
|
|
ERR | ;
|
|
INS(DATA,VALUE) | ; EP -- AGG LOOKUP INSURANCE
|
|
SAM(DATA,DFN) | ; EP -- AGG POLICY HOLDER SAME TRIG
|
|
INIT(DATA,AGGPLIEN) | ;EP -- AGG INSUR INITIAL TRIG
|
|
UP | ;
|
|
PTN(DATA,AGGPTDFN) | ; EP -- AGG POLICY HOLDER PAT TRIG
|
|
CHK(BFLD) | ;EP - Check for definition of a field
|
|
EN(DATA,AGGPIHLN) | ;EP -- AGG POLICY HOLDER TRIGGER
|
|
POL(LDATA,VALUE,INSRUR) | ;EP -- AGG POLICY HOLDER LOOKUP
; Lookup policy holder by name (VALUE) and selected insurer (INSRUR) |
|
PAT(LDATA,VALUE) | ;EP -- AGG POLICY HOLDER PATIENT
|
Name | Field # of Occurrence |
---|---|
^%ZTER | ERR+1 |
FND^AGGPTLKP | PAT+4 |
$$FMTE^AGGUL1 | EN+24, EN+25, EN+27, SAM+14, PTN+13 |
$$TKO^AGGUL1 | INS+32 |
LKP^AGGWTBLK | POL+6 |
FIND^DIC | INS+17 |
FIELD^DID | CHK+2, CHK+3, CHK+4 |
$$GET1^DIQ | SAM+15, SAM+16, SAM+17, SAM+18, SAM+19, SAM+20, SAM+21, PTN+14, PTN+15, PTN+16 , PTN+17, PTN+18, PTN+19, PTN+20, INS+42, INS+44 |
$$NOW^XLFDT | ERR+3 |
RPC Name | Call Tags |
---|---|
AGG LOOKUP INSURANCE | INS |
AGG POLICY HOLDER LOOKUP | POL |
AGG POLICY HOLDER PATIENT | PAT |
AGG POLICY HOLDER TRIGGER | EN |
AGG POLICY HOLDER PAT TRIG | PTN |
AGG POLICY HOLDER SAME TRIG | SAM |
AGG INSUR INITIAL TRIG | INIT |
AGG INSUR COV TRIGGER | COV |
FileNo | Call Tags |
---|---|
^DPT - [#2] | GET1^DIQ |
^AUPNPAT - [#9000001] | GET1^DIQ |
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^AUPN3PPH - [#9000003.1] | INIT+12, EN+13, EN+14, EN+15, EN+16, EN+17, EN+18, EN+19, EN+20, EN+21 , EN+22, EN+23, EN+24, EN+25, EN+26, EN+27, EN+28, EN+29, EN+30, EN+32 , POL+11 |
^AUTNEGRP - [#9999999.77] | EN+30, EN+32 |
^AUTTPIC - [#9999999.65] | COV+15 |
^AUTTPIC("C" | COV+11, COV+12, COV+14 |
^AUTTRLSH("B" | SAM+12 |
^DD("DD" | ERR+3 |
^DPT - [#2] | SAM+11, SAM+13, SAM+14, PTN+11, PTN+12, PTN+13 |
^TMP("AGGINSCV" | COV+3 |
^TMP("AGGINSLK" | INS+3 |
^TMP("AGGPHPAT" | PTN+3 |
^TMP("AGGPHPOL" | EN+3 |
^TMP("AGGPHSAME" | SAM+3 |
^TMP("AGGPINIT" | INIT+3 |
^TMP("AGGPOLH" | POL+4 |
^TMP("AGGPOLHP" | PAT+3 |
^TMP("DILIST" | INS+21 |
Name | Line Occurrences |
---|---|
CHK | INS+27, INS+29, INS+30 |
HDR | INIT+8, EN+8, SAM+8, PTN+8, COV+8 |
UP | INIT+10, INIT+12, INIT+13, EN+13, EN+14, EN+15, EN+16, EN+17, EN+18, EN+19 , EN+20, EN+21, EN+22, EN+23, EN+24, EN+25, EN+26, EN+27, EN+28, EN+29 , EN+31, EN+33, SAM+10, SAM+11, SAM+12, SAM+13, SAM+14, SAM+15, SAM+16, SAM+17 , SAM+18, SAM+19, SAM+20, SAM+21, PTN+11, PTN+12, PTN+13, PTN+14, PTN+15, PTN+16 , PTN+17, PTN+18, PTN+19, PTN+20, COV+11, COV+16 |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
ABLE | INIT+1~, INIT+10*, INIT+12*, INIT+13*, EN+1~, EN+13*, EN+14*, EN+15*, EN+16*, EN+17* , EN+18*, EN+19*, EN+20*, EN+21*, EN+22*, EN+23*, EN+24*, EN+25*, EN+26*, EN+27* , EN+28*, EN+29*, EN+31*, EN+33*, SAM+1~, SAM+10*, SAM+11*, SAM+12*, SAM+13*, SAM+14* , SAM+15*, SAM+16*, SAM+17*, SAM+18*, SAM+19*, SAM+20*, SAM+21*, PTN+1~, PTN+11*, PTN+12* , PTN+13*, PTN+14*, PTN+15*, PTN+16*, PTN+17*, PTN+18*, PTN+19*, PTN+20*, UP+1, COV+1~ , COV+10* |
AGGPIHLN | EN~, EN+11, EN+12, EN+13, EN+14, EN+15, EN+16, EN+17, EN+18, EN+19 , EN+20, EN+21, EN+22, EN+23, EN+24, EN+25, EN+26, EN+27, EN+28, EN+29 , EN+30, EN+32 |
AGGPIINS | COV~, COV+11, COV+12, COV+14 |
AGGPLIEN | INIT~, INIT+10, INIT+11, INIT+12 |
AGGPTDFN | PTN~, PTN+10, PTN+11, PTN+12, PTN+13, PTN+14, PTN+15, PTN+16, PTN+17, PTN+18 , PTN+19, PTN+20 |
AGN | POL+2~, POL+8*, POL+9*, POL+10, POL+13 |
AGTYPE | INS+11~, INS+44*, INS+46, INS+47, INS+48, INS+49, INS+50, INS+51, INS+52, INS+54 |
BFLD | CHK~, CHK+2, CHK+3, CHK+4 |
>> BMXSEC | INS+19*, ERR+4* |
BQX | CHK+8! |
BQX("FIELD LE | NGTH" , CHK+6 |
BQX("LABEL" | CHK+7 |
BQX("TYPE" | CHK+5 |
CFLAG | SAM+1~, SAM+11*, SAM+12*, SAM+13*, SAM+14*, SAM+15*, SAM+16*, SAM+17*, SAM+18*, SAM+19* , SAM+20*, SAM+21*, UP+1 |
CLEAR | INIT+1~, INIT+10*, INIT+12*, INIT+13*, EN+1~, EN+13*, EN+14*, EN+15*, EN+16*, EN+17* , EN+18*, EN+19*, EN+20*, EN+21*, EN+22*, EN+23*, EN+24*, EN+25*, EN+26*, EN+27* , EN+28*, EN+29*, EN+31*, EN+33*, SAM+1~, SAM+10*, SAM+11*, SAM+12*, SAM+13*, SAM+14* , SAM+15*, SAM+16*, SAM+17*, SAM+18*, SAM+19*, SAM+20*, SAM+21*, PTN+1~, PTN+11*, PTN+12* , PTN+13*, PTN+14*, PTN+15*, PTN+16*, PTN+17*, PTN+18*, PTN+19*, PTN+20*, UP+1, COV+1~ , COV+10* |
DATA | INIT~, INIT+3*, INIT+4, INIT+9, INIT+14, EN~, EN+3*, EN+4, EN+9, EN+35 , SAM~, SAM+3*, SAM+4, SAM+9, SAM+22, PTN~, PTN+3*, PTN+4, PTN+9, PTN+22 , UP+1, INS~, INS+3*, INS+4, INS+33, INS+55, INS+57, ERR+5, COV~, COV+3* , COV+4, COV+9, COV+17 |
DDATA | INS+1~, INS+21*, INS+22, INS+36, INS+39, INS+40, INS+43*, INS+44, INS+54*, INS+55 |
DESC | INS+11~, INS+38~, INS+42*, INS+43 |
DFN | SAM~, SAM+10, SAM+11, SAM+13, SAM+14, SAM+15, SAM+16, SAM+17, SAM+18, SAM+19 , SAM+20, SAM+21 |
DLEN | CHK+1~, CHK+6*, CHK+7 |
DT | POL+12 |
>> ECHR | POL+7* |
ERRDTM | ERR+2~, ERR+3*, ERR+4 |
ERROR | INS+12~, INS+19 |
ERROR("DIERR" | INS+19 |
EXP | POL+2~, POL+11*, POL+12 |
FIELD | INS+11~, INS+15*, INS+17 |
FILE | INS+11~, INS+13*, INS+17 |
FLAGS | INS+11~, INS+15*, INS+17 |
FNBR | POL+5*, POL+6, INS+1~, INS+9*, INS+13, INS+42, INS+44, CHK+2, CHK+3, CHK+4 |
>> GROUP | EN+32* |
HDR | INIT+1~, INIT+9, EN+1~, EN+9, SAM+1~, SAM+9, PTN+1~, PTN+9, HDR+1*, INS+12~ , INS+24*, INS+26*, INS+27*, INS+29*, INS+30*, INS+31*, INS+32*, INS+33, COV+1~, COV+9 |
HELP | INIT+1~, INIT+10*, INIT+12*, INIT+13*, EN+1~, EN+13*, EN+14*, EN+15*, EN+16*, EN+17* , EN+18*, EN+19*, EN+20*, EN+21*, EN+22*, EN+23*, EN+24*, EN+25*, EN+26*, EN+27* , EN+28*, EN+29*, EN+31*, EN+33*, SAM+1~, SAM+10*, SAM+11*, SAM+12*, SAM+13*, SAM+14* , SAM+15*, SAM+16*, SAM+17*, SAM+18*, SAM+19*, SAM+20*, SAM+21*, PTN+1~, PTN+11*, PTN+12* , PTN+13*, PTN+14*, PTN+15*, PTN+16*, PTN+17*, PTN+18*, PTN+19*, PTN+20*, UP+1, COV+1~ , COV+10*, COV+11* |
IEN | INS+11~, INS+38~, INS+39*, INS+42, COV+13*, COV+14*, COV+15 |
II | INIT+1~, INIT+5*, INIT+9, INIT+14*, EN+1~, EN+5*, EN+9, EN+35*, SAM+1~, SAM+5* , SAM+9, SAM+22*, PTN+1~, PTN+5*, PTN+9, PTN+22*, UP+1*, POL+2~, PAT+1~, INS+1~ , INS+6*, INS+33, INS+55*, INS+57*, ERR+5*, COV+1~, COV+5*, COV+9, COV+17* |
INDEX | INS+11~, INS+13*, INS+15*, INS+17 |
INSRUR | POL~, POL+5 |
JJ | INS+11~, INS+35*, INS+36*, INS+39, INS+40, INS+43, INS+44, INS+54, INS+55 |
LDATA | POL~, POL+4*, POL+6, POL+7, POL+9, POL+10, POL+13, PAT~, PAT+3*, PAT+4 , PAT+5* |
>> LG | POL+7* |
LPC | INS+1~, INS+54* |
MAP | INS+12~, INS+22*, INS+23, INS+25, INS+26, INS+27, INS+28, INS+37 |
MII | INS+12~, INS+25*, INS+26, INS+27, INS+28 |
NFLD | INS+12~, INS+28*, INS+29*, INS+30 |
NUMB | INS+11~, INS+13* |
PIEN | POL+2~, POL+10*, POL+11 |
QFL | INS+38~, INS+39* |
SCREEN | POL+5*, POL+6, INS+12~, INS+14*, INS+17 |
SOURCE | INIT+1~, INIT+10*, INIT+12*, INIT+13*, EN+1~, EN+13*, EN+14*, EN+15*, EN+16*, EN+17* , EN+18*, EN+19*, EN+20*, EN+21*, EN+22*, EN+23*, EN+24*, EN+25*, EN+26*, EN+27* , EN+28*, EN+29*, EN+30*, EN+33*, SAM+1~, SAM+10*, SAM+11*, SAM+12*, SAM+13*, SAM+14* , SAM+15*, SAM+16*, SAM+17*, SAM+18*, SAM+19*, SAM+20*, SAM+21*, PTN+1~, PTN+11*, PTN+12* , PTN+13*, PTN+14*, PTN+15*, PTN+16*, PTN+17*, PTN+18*, PTN+19*, PTN+20*, UP+1, COV+1~ , COV+10* |
TEXT | INS+11~, INS+38~, INS+40*, INS+41, INS+47, INS+48 |
TYPE | INIT+1~, INIT+10*, INIT+12*, INIT+13*, EN+1~, EN+13*, EN+14*, EN+15*, EN+16*, EN+17* , EN+18*, EN+19*, EN+20*, EN+21*, EN+22*, EN+23*, EN+24*, EN+25*, EN+26*, EN+27* , EN+28*, EN+29*, EN+31*, EN+33*, SAM+1~, SAM+10*, SAM+11*, SAM+12*, SAM+13*, SAM+14* , SAM+15*, SAM+16*, SAM+17*, SAM+18*, SAM+19*, SAM+20*, SAM+21*, PTN+1~, PTN+11*, PTN+12* , PTN+13*, PTN+14*, PTN+15*, PTN+16*, PTN+17*, PTN+18*, PTN+19*, PTN+20*, UP+1, INS+12~ , INS+27, INS+29, INS+30, CHK+5*, CHK+7*, COV+1~, COV+10* |
U | INIT+12, EN+13, EN+14, EN+15, EN+16, EN+17, EN+18, EN+19, EN+20, EN+21 , EN+22, EN+23, EN+24, EN+25, EN+26, EN+27, EN+28, EN+29, EN+30, EN+32 , SAM+11, SAM+13, SAM+14, PTN+11, PTN+12, PTN+13, UP+1, POL+10, POL+11, PAT+5 , INS+39, INS+40, INS+43, INS+44, INS+54, COV+15 |
UID | INIT+1~, INIT+2*, INIT+3, EN+1~, EN+2*, EN+3, SAM+1~, SAM+2*, SAM+3, PTN+1~ , PTN+2*, PTN+3, POL+2~, POL+3*, POL+4, PAT+1~, PAT+2*, PAT+3, INS+1~, INS+2* , INS+3, INS+21, COV+1~, COV+2*, COV+3 |
VALUE | INIT+1~, INIT+10*, INIT+12*, INIT+13*, EN+1~, EN+13*, EN+14*, EN+15*, EN+16*, EN+17* , EN+18*, EN+19*, EN+20*, EN+21*, EN+22*, EN+23*, EN+24*, EN+25*, EN+26*, EN+27* , EN+28*, EN+29*, EN+30*, EN+32*, SAM+1~, SAM+10*, SAM+11*, SAM+12*, SAM+13*, SAM+14* , SAM+15*, SAM+16*, SAM+17*, SAM+18*, SAM+19*, SAM+20*, SAM+21*, PTN+1~, PTN+11*, PTN+12* , PTN+13*, PTN+14*, PTN+15*, PTN+16*, PTN+17*, PTN+18*, PTN+19*, PTN+20*, UP+1, POL~ , POL+6, PAT~, PAT+4, INS~, INS+9*, INS+17, COV+1~, COV+10*, COV+13*, COV+15* |
WINDOW | INS+11~, INS+45*, INS+46*, INS+47*, INS+48*, INS+49*, INS+50*, INS+51*, INS+52*, INS+53* , INS+54 |
X | INS+1~ |
XTLKUT | INS+12~ |
Y | ERR+2~, ERR+3* |
>> ZTSK | INIT+2, EN+2, SAM+2, PTN+2, POL+3, PAT+2, INS+2, COV+2 |